The existance of livestock waste increase in accordance with the consumption of livestock meat.Livestock waste itself can be faeces, bone, blood, and hair. The handling of this wastes must be done correctly so that they doesn’t contaminate the environment. One of the product that can be produced from the processing of livestock waste is bone powder which can be used as the mixture of animal feed because it’s rich in calcium and phosphorus. The aim of this research was to test of the effect of workload Dry Cow Bone Miller, with the parameters of effective capacity, yield and power, then analyze the economic value of dry cow bone miller. This research was conducted in August until October 2016 in the Laboratory of Agricultural Engineering, Faculty of Agriculture, University of North Sumatra, Medan, by literature study, testing of equipment and parameters observation. Parameters measured were effective capacity, yield and power. The results showed that the workload was significantly affected the effective capacity, yield and poweren_US
